結果

問題 No.1398 調和の魔法陣 (構築)
ユーザー Kude
提出日時 2021-02-19 22:04:56
言語 PyPy3
(7.3.15)
結果
AC  
実行時間 100 ms / 3,153 ms
コード長 427 bytes
コンパイル時間 319 ms
コンパイル使用メモリ 81,920 KB
実行使用メモリ 82,692 KB
最終ジャッジ日時 2024-09-16 19:19:39
合計ジャッジ時間 28,911 ms
ジャッジサーバーID
(参考情報)
judge1 / judge6
このコードへのチャレンジ
(要ログイン)
ファイルパターン 結果
sample AC * 3
other AC * 28
権限があれば一括ダウンロードができます

ソースコード

diff #
プレゼンテーションモードにする

w, h, x = map(int, input().split())
d = [[0] * 3 for _ in range(3)]
for i in range(3):
for j in range(3):
if h % 3 != i % 3 != 2 and w % 3 != j % 3 != 2:
d[i][j] = min(x, 9)
x -= d[i][j]
if x:
print(-1)
exit()
ans = []
for i in range(h):
ans.append([])
for j in range(w):
ans[-1].append(d[i%3][j%3])
for t in ans:
for x in t:
print(x, end='')
print()
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
0